Head of IEA: COP29 can be turning point in transition to “pure” energy in Azerbaijan

COP29 can be a turning point in the transition to the “pure” energy in Azerbaijan and beyond. This was said by an interview with Trend Executive Director of the International Energy Agency (IEA) Fatih Birol.

“For many years, there have been good, mutually beneficial relations between Azerbaijan and Europe. Azerbaijan has already proved that it is a reliable energy partner of Europe, supplying energy over the southern gas corridor. The country also has huge potential both in the field of wind and solar energy The government takes steps in this direction and has good plans for the maximum use of the potential of renewable energy.

Birol believes that if these plans are implemented, Azerbaijan can become a good partner of Europe and in the field of “pure” energy.

“There are many striking examples in this regard, including the project of laying a cable along the bottom of the Black Sea. According to him, Azerbaijan has already taken certain steps in the field of “pure” energy, but this is only a few percentage points from all the potential that the country has.

“Therefore, I really hope that this potential will be completely, if not completely, then to a large extent used, first of all, in the domestic market of Azerbaijan,” said the Executive Director of the MAI.
